Transaction 26bf81d497484d66171cfd32df52e6714bf8fdc5bd89b66af8d15318f421705d
1 Input
1 Output
-
26bf81d497484d66171cfd32df52e6714bf8fdc5bd89b66af8d15318f421705d:0
- value
- 168447
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d6cd61911b6ae616884b8dd6d05da4c25e9c9b9 OP_EQUAL
- address
- 3D8CmbuYhLEmzoUytHLJ6qzwKZfyWJ3GZV